A variety of foundation drainage solutions can be effectively implemented to suit different properties, including:
- French Drains: These systems comprise perforated pipes embedded in gravel trenches designed to facilitate the efficient movement of water away from the foundation.
- Sump Pumps: Engineered to remove excess water from basements or crawl spaces, these devices are essential for providing effective flood protection.
- Grading: This landscaping technique involves contouring the land to slope away from the foundation, enhancing water drainage efficiency.
- Drainage Tiles: Installed around the foundation, these tiles serve to effectively collect and redirect water away from the structure.
- Surface Drains: These systems capture surface runoff and redirect it away from your property, preventing water accumulation.
- Waterproofing Membrane: A protective barrier applied to foundation walls, this membrane helps prevent moisture penetration.

Identify the Key Drainage Challenges Unique to Pitt Meadows
Pitt Meadows presents a distinctive set of drainage challenges influenced by its specific soil types and climatic conditions. The local clay soil, while generally stable, tends to retain moisture, leading to water accumulation around foundations, particularly following heavy rainfall. This excess moisture can induce foundation cracks, compromising the structural integrity of homes in the region.
Other common drainage issues faced in Pitt Meadows include:
- Flooding: Intense rainfall can overwhelm existing drainage systems, resulting in localized flooding.
- Surface Runoff: Poorly designed landscapes may inadvertently direct water towards foundations instead of away from them, exacerbating drainage issues.
- Inadequate Drainage Systems: Many older homes might feature outdated drainage solutions that are ill-equipped to handle contemporary weather patterns.
- Tree Roots: Roots from nearby trees can infiltrate drainage systems, obstructing water flow and causing further complications.

Stay Updated on the Latest Innovations in Drainage Technology for Enhanced Performance
The field of foundation drainage has experienced remarkable technological advancements that enhance the efficiency and longevity of drainage systems. Recent innovations include smart drainage solutions that leverage sensors and IoT technology to monitor water levels and detect potential issues in real-time, allowing for proactive measures.
One significant advancement is the integration of green infrastructure, such as permeable pavements and rain gardens, which effectively manage stormwater while benefiting the environment. These technologies not only improve drainage but also enhance the aesthetic appeal of properties, making them more desirable.
Another notable development is the use of high-density polyethylene (HDPE) pipes, which are more resistant to corrosion and root intrusion. This advancement ensures that homeowners can expect a longer-lasting solution that requires less maintenance over time, providing even greater peace of mind.

Key Components Integral to a High-Performing Drainage System
An effective foundation drainage system comprises several critical components that collaborate seamlessly to redirect water away from your home. Each element plays a vital role in ensuring that your foundation remains dry and protected from potential water damage.
The primary components include:
- Drainage Pipes: These pipes transport water away from the foundation and are typically installed at the footing level to ensure maximum efficiency and effectiveness.
- Sump Pumps: Essential for homes with basements, sump pumps collect and expel excess water from the lowest points of the home, preventing flooding and water-related issues.
- Grading: The slope of the land surrounding your home should guide water away from the foundation, effectively preventing pooling and safeguarding the structure.
- Downspouts: These direct rainwater from roof gutters away from the foundation, minimising water accumulation and potential drainage problems.
- Catch Basins: Installed in low-lying areas, these devices gather surface water to help prevent flooding and protect your home.

Your Detailed Step-by-Step Guide to Effectively Installing Drainage Systems
The process of installing a foundation drainage system is intricate and requires careful planning and execution. Initially, professionals will conduct a thorough site assessment to determine the most suitable drainage solution based on your property’s unique characteristics and needs.
The typical steps involved in the installation process include:
- Site Assessment: Drainage experts evaluate the landscape, soil type, and existing water issues to determine the best course of action for your property.
- Design Planning: Following the assessment, a customized drainage plan is created to address specific needs and challenges identified during the evaluation.
- Excavation: This step involves digging trenches for drainage pipes, sump pumps, and other components to ensure proper placement and functionality.
- Installation: Components of the drainage system are installed, ensuring proper alignment and connection for optimal performance.
- Backfilling: Once installed, trenches are backfilled with soil or gravel to secure the components in place and restore the landscape.
- Final Grading: The landscape is graded to ensure water flows away from the foundation, effectively preventing pooling and potential water damage.

Essential Maintenance Tips for Ensuring Long-Term Foundation Protection
Regular maintenance of your foundation drainage system is crucial for ensuring its longevity and effectiveness. Neglecting maintenance can lead to significant issues down the line, including water damage and costly repairs that could have been avoided with timely intervention.
To maintain your drainage system in optimal condition, consider these essential maintenance tips:
- Regular Inspections: Periodically check the drainage system for blockages, damage, or signs of wear and tear that might compromise its function and efficiency.
- Clean Gutters and Downspouts: Ensure that gutters and downspouts are free from debris to prevent overflow and potential water pooling around your foundation.
- Monitor Sump Pumps: Regularly test sump pumps to confirm they are functioning correctly and efficiently, especially before heavy rain events, to avoid flooding.
- Check Grading: Be vigilant for shifts in landscaping that may affect water flow away from the foundation, adjusting as necessary to maintain drainage efficiency.
- Clear Drainage Pipes: Ensure that drainage pipes remain unobstructed and free from debris to facilitate proper water flow and prevent backups.
